Minister Karki receives ‘Bhai Tika’



KATHMANDU: Minister for Communications and Information Technology, Gyanendra Bahadur Karki, received ‘Bhai Tika’ from his younger sister Tara Thapa.

The Minister received ‘Bhai Tika’ from her sister at latter’s residence based in Bhaisepati of Lalitpur on the auspicious hour of 11:37 am Thursday.

Minister’s younger brothers Devendra Karki and Dr Mrigendra Karki also received ‘Bhai Tika’ along with him.

The day of ‘Bhai Tika’ is celebrated as the main day of the five-day Tihar festival.
